在搜索引擎优化(SEO)的实战中,站群策略一直是备受争议却又极具效果的手段。然而,许多站长在搭建好站群后,却陷入了“盲目操作”的困境,最核心的痛点就是无法准确评估每个站点在搜索引擎中的表现。想要实现精准的流量增长与权重提升,掌握一套高效的站群排名查询方法至关重要。本文将为你拆解从数据获取到策略调整的全流程技术细节,帮助你告别无效操作,真正掌控站群的核心命脉。
一、为什么站群排名查询是效果的关键起点?
很多新手认为,只要批量注册域名、批量发布内容,站群就能自动带来流量。这种想法是极其危险的。站群的核心价值在于“规模化”与“差异化”,而这一切的基础都建立在精确的排名数据之上。
通过站群排名查询,你可以实时掌握每个站点在主要搜索引擎(如百度、谷歌)中的关键词排名位置。例如,你拥有50个站点,每个站点针对不同的长尾关键词。如果不进行查询,你可能会将大量资源浪费在排名在50名以外的站点上,而忽略那些已经排名在10名左右、只需稍加优化就能冲进前三的站点。具体操作上,建议使用专业工具(如Ahrefs、SEMrush或自建爬虫)批量抓取排名数据,并设定每日更新。如果发现某个站点的某个关键词在3天内提升了5个名次,应立刻为该站点增加高质量外链或补充原创内容,以巩固上升势头。
二、技术实操:如何构建高效的站群排名查询系统?
手动查询每个站点的排名效率极低,而且容易触发搜索引擎的访问限制。以下是一套基于Python脚本的自动化查询方案,可帮助你实现高效的站群排名查询。
首先,你需要一个包含所有站点域名和对应目标关键词的CSV文件。然后,利用以下核心代码模拟搜索并截取排名数据:
import requests
from bs4 import BeautifulSoup
import time
def check_rank(domain, keyword):
url = f"https://www.google.com/search?q={keyword}&num=100"
headers = {'User-Agent': '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36'}
response = requests.get(url, headers=headers)
soup = BeautifulSoup(response.text, 'html.parser')
for index, result in enumerate(soup.select('.g')):
link = result.find('a')
if link and domain in link['href']:
return index + 1
return None
# 读取CSV并循环查询
# 注意:需添加随机延迟,避免IP被封
此脚本的关键在于两点:第一,将查询结果数量(num)设置为100,确保能捕获到较深排名的站点;第二,每次查询后必须加入3-5秒的随机延迟(time.sleep(random.uniform(3,5)))。运行该脚本后,会生成一个包含“站点-关键词-当前排名”的三列表格。你可以根据这张表,快速筛选出排名在1-3页(即前30名)的站点作为重点优化对象,而对排名在50名以外的站点进行内容或结构上的大幅度调整。
三、数据驱动:基于站群排名查询的优化策略
拿到排名数据后,不要只盯着数字看。真正的价值在于如何解读并行动。以下是三个基于数据的实战策略:
- 层级化资源分配:将所有站点按排名分为三个层级。排名1-10的站点投入60%的资源(如顶级外链、高频更新),排名11-30的站点投入30%的资源,其余站点投入10%的资源。例如,你发现一个站点“example-a.com”在关键词“蓝色运动鞋”上排名第8,那么你应该立即为该站点撰写一篇深度测评文章,并联系行业博客进行外链交换。
- 关键词交叉保护:通过站群排名查询,你会发现多个站点可能同时竞争同一个关键词。这时候,必须进行内部调整。例如,如果“site1.com”和“site2.com”都在优化“跑步鞋推荐”,且排名分别为第5和第12,那么你应该将“site2.com”上关于该关键词的内容进行重定向或改写,指向一个更细分的领域,如“宽脚跑步鞋推荐”,以避免内部竞争,同时占据更多搜索结果位。
- 异常波动监控:建立排名波动阈值。例如,当某个站点在24小时内排名下降超过10位,系统应立即发送警报。此时,你需要检查该站点是否被搜索引擎降权,或者是否有竞争对手进行了恶意操作。通过分析查询数据的时间序列,你可以提前发现潜在风险,避免整个站群受到牵连。
四、常见误区:千万别把站群排名查询变成“自杀式”操作
很多SEO从业者在进行站群排名查询时,往往会陷入两个致命误区。第一,过度频繁查询。有些人为了追求实时数据,每10分钟就对同一个关键词查询一次。这会导致你的IP被搜索引擎加入黑名单,整个站群的数据都会受到污染。建议每天只在固定时间(如凌晨3点)进行一次批量查询,其他时间只分析历史数据。
第二,忽略数据源差异。百度与谷歌的排名算法差异巨大。例如,在百度上排名第一的站点,在谷歌可能根本搜不到。因此,你的查询系统必须针对不同搜索引擎设置不同的参数。对于百度,建议使用百度搜索资源平台的API接口,或者模拟移动端搜索,因为百度对移动端的索引权重更高。同时,要注意区分自然排名和广告排名,在抓取结果时,务必过滤掉带有“广告”标签的条目,否则你的数据会严重失真。
结语
站群排名查询不是终点,而是优化循环的起点。它帮你从混沌的数据中看清方向,将有限的精力投入到最有可能产生回报的站点上。记住,一个精准的查询系统,远比100个低质量的站点更有价值。从今天开始,停止盲目的内容堆砌,用数据武装你的站群,你将看到流量与权重的稳步提升。